Question: What is the purpose of a 'key performance indicator' (KPI) in supply chain management?

Answer options: ✅ To measure and evaluate the effectiveness of supply chain processes

  • To define the legal terms of supplier contracts
  • To automate inventory reordering decisions
  • To set minimum ethical standards for supplier conduct

Correct answer: To measure and evaluate the effectiveness of supply chain processes

Explanation: KPIs are quantifiable measures used to track and assess the performance of various aspects of the supply chain against strategic goals.
